C#反转字符串的两种方法
2010-11-12 13:16
302 查看
1
public static string ReverseByArray(this string original)
{
char[] c = original.ToCharArray();
Array.Reverse(c);
return new string(c);
}
2
public static string ReverseByCharBuffer(this string original)
{
char[] c = original.ToCharArray();
int l = original.Length;
char[] o = new char[l];
for (int i = 0 ;i < l; i++)
{
o[i] = c[l-i-1];
}
return new string(o);
}
public static string ReverseByArray(this string original)
{
char[] c = original.ToCharArray();
Array.Reverse(c);
return new string(c);
}
2
public static string ReverseByCharBuffer(this string original)
{
char[] c = original.ToCharArray();
int l = original.Length;
char[] o = new char[l];
for (int i = 0 ;i < l; i++)
{
o[i] = c[l-i-1];
}
return new string(o);
}
相关文章推荐
- 英文字符串第一个字符大写C#和Javascript两种实现方法
- C#将DataSet转成Xml的方法(转字符串和文件两种)
- C#反转字符串效率最高的方法
- C#实现数字字符串左补齐0的两种方法
- php反转输出字符串(两种方法)
- C#反转字符串效率最高的方法
- 将字符串反转的两种方法
- C#反转字符串效率最高的方法
- C#实现数字字符串左补齐0的两种方法
- C语言两种方法实现字符串反转
- C# 实现数字字符串左补齐0的两种方法
- C#实现数字字符串左补齐0的两种方法
- [C#]几种字符串反转方法效率比较
- C# 实现数字字符串左补齐0的两种方法
- c#连续输出一串字符串的代码(两种方法)
- C#--第九周实验--任务2--定义一个静态成员方法,该方法实现字符串反转。
- 字符串反转的两种方法
- js实现字符串反转的两种方法
- [C#]几种字符串反转方法效率比较
- 在进行C#编程时候,有的时候我们需要判断一个字符串是否是数字字符串,我们可以通过以下两种方法来实现。 【方法一】:使用 try{} catch{} 语句。 我们可以在try语句块中试图